Hey guys, i am a complete newbie. Picked up my first corvette. It is a 1998 with z06 heads, intake, and comp cam (not sure the cam model / part #)and a Corsa Titanium exhaust with headers (with no O2 sensors installed)

Question: When the car idles it will briefly idle at 1k rpm but then it will drop down to 500rpm or a little lower (like almost stalling) and spike back up and continue to do this. Previous owner said the spark plugs are 2 stages colder for a nitorus system that was installed. Is this all from the cam or Colder plugs or possibly the 02 sensors not being installed or maybe its something else? Car runs fine its just kind of annoying.

First things first, put new plugs and wires in no matter what. Suggestion, NGK TR-55 and MSD wires. Just so you're 100% sure there's good plugs and wires in it. See if that helps. You can pick up MSD wires (long lasting) and NGK plugs in a combo from numerous places for only around $80.

If you have long tube headers and an off-road X or H pipe (no cats) the front two O2 sensors should be plugged into the headers and the rear O2 sensors won't be used. The rear O2 sensors codes should already be deleted from tuning.

My advice, if it doesn't run right after adding new plugs and wires, maybe look into getting it tuned at a reputable performance shop due to having heads, cam, intake, exhaust mods. You want to be certian it's tuned correctly. Tuning has everything to do with these engines.

Could be plugs, could be a vacuum leak, could be IAC, could be MAF needs cleaning, could be tune... I'd find a mechanic familiar with LS1's and go from there. Did it not do this before you purchased it?

I had a vaccum leak that was causing this..At the time, my car was only 'tuned' by my Hypertech programmer BTW. Now witht he full tune, its gone and way better. Will still idle around 1200 rpm when cold and goes down to 1000 after.

TR55 for the win; you dont need colder plug N/A. Do the wires too while at it. I have MSD and they last longer than my GM LS6 wires..
